在数字货币快速发展的今天,以太坊作为一种重要的区块链技术,其应用越来越广泛。很多用户由于各种原因,可能...
在数字货币的世界中,拥有一个以太坊(Ethereum)钱包是进行交易或投资的第一步。以太坊是一个开源的区块链平台,它允许开发者构建去中心化的应用程序(DApps)和执行智能合约。而管理这些资产的关键工具就是钱包,它不仅存储用户的以太币(ETH)和其他代币,还包含了与之相关的公私钥对。为了确保只有钱包的合法拥有者能够操作这些资产,签名证明机制应运而生。
签名证明是如何工作的呢?通过使用数学算法,用户可以使用其私钥对一组数据进行签名。任何拥有相应公钥的人,都可以验证这个签名,以确认该签名确实由对应的私钥产生。这种机制确保了钱包所有权的安全性和隐私性,同时也提供了防篡改的保障。在下文中,我们将详细探讨以太坊钱包所有权的签名证明方法,以及整个流程中的细节问题。
在深入签名证明之前,我们需要首先理解区块链和钱包的基本概念。
区块链是一种去中心化的分布式账本技术。这意味着所有的交易记录和数据是存储在全球范围内的多个节点上的,而不是单一的中心化服务器。这种结构保护了数据的完整性和安全性,避免了单点故障或数据篡改的风险。
钱包则是在区块链上管理数字资产的工具。可以将其看作是一个电子钱包,允许用户存储和管理他们的加密货币。以太坊钱包分为热钱包和冷钱包两大类。热钱包是在线的,便于快速交易,但安全性较低;冷钱包则是离线的,安全性高但交易不便。
签名证明是验证身份和所有权的一种方法。它使用比特币和以太坊等系统中的公钥密码学,实现了安全可靠的交易和身份验证。
首先,用户拥有一个公钥和一个私钥。公钥类似于银行的账户号码,任何人都可以看到;而私钥则类似于银行卡的密码,只有拥有这把钥匙的人才能管理账户内的资产。用户可以利用私钥对一些数据进行签名,以证明自己是对应公钥的拥有者。
这个过程的基本步骤如下:
通过这一过程,无需透露私钥,用户就能够证明自己是钱包的合法拥有者。也就是说,签名证明是一种所有权的不可否认的证明。
签名证明在以太坊和其他区块链系统中的重要性不可忽视,原因如下:
签名证明为用户的数字资产提供了一层安全保障。从根本上说,没有私钥,就无法发起交易。这种机制防止了未授权的访问和操作,确保了数字资产的安全性。一旦钱包的私钥被盗,恶意者可以随时对钱包进行操作,给用户带来不可估量的损失。
由于区块链技术本身是去中心化的,因此它不依赖于第三方机构来审核身份和交易。用户只需利用私钥进行签名,任何人都无法篡改或伪造交易。这种机制减少了信任的需求,用户不必依赖中央机构来确保交易的合法性。
签名证明的另一大优点是提高了用户的隐私性。用户只需共享公钥,而无需披露私钥或个人信息。即使在进行交易的过程中,用户的信息也不会被暴露,从而保护了用户的隐私。
接下来,我们将讨论如何在实际操作中使用以太坊签名证明钱包所有权的具体步骤。
首先,用户需要拥有一个以太坊钱包。用户可以选择热钱包或冷钱包,这取决于他们对安全性和方便性的需求。例如,MetaMask就是一种常见的热钱包,用户可以安装该插件,创建自己以太坊地址并保存相应的密钥。
在拥有钱包后,用户可以使用钱包软件或相关工具生成签名。例如,如果用户要发送一笔交易,他们只需输入交易信息(如接收地址和转账金额),然后点击发送;钱包软件会自动使用私钥对该交易数据进行签名。
在交易发起后,用户可以将生成的签名和交易信息提供给对方或其他参与者。对方可以使用用户的公钥和签名来验证该交易的有效性。如果验证成功,这笔交易就被认为是合法的,资产就会按计划转移。
最后,一旦交易被矿工打包并包含在区块中,这笔交易就被永久记录在以太坊区块链上。这个过程是透明和开放的,所有人都可以查看这个交易的历史,但不会损害用户的隐私。
以下是用户在使用以太坊签名证明钱包所有权时可能会遇到的一些常见问题。
私钥是用户管理钱包资产的唯一凭证,因此保护私钥至关重要。以下是几种保护私钥的建议:
首先,用户应将私钥保存在一个安全的地方,例如使用硬件钱包。硬件钱包是一种专用设备,私钥保存在设备内部,不会暴露给互联网,有效地减少了被黑客攻击的风险。
其二,用户不应在网络上分享私钥或在不安全的环境中输入私钥。即使在看似安全的场所,也要保持警惕,确保操作的安全性。
此外,定期备份私钥或助记词也是一个好习惯。这可以防止因设备损坏或丢失导致的资金损失。用户可以将备份保存在纸张上、U盘中或其他安全的地方,确保仅自己可访问。
最后,启用双重身份验证(2FA)和安全密码也是增强资产安全的重要举措。通过这些措施,用户可以在一定程度上降低私钥被盗用的风险。
在以太坊及其他区块链上,私钥是唯一能够控制钱包资产的凭证。如果用户丢失了私钥,通常很难或者说几乎不可能找回钱包中的资产。这是区块链技术的核心特性之一,去中心化意味着没有中央机构可以重置或恢复账户。
然而,在创建钱包时,用户一般会获得一个助记词(seed phrase),这个助记词可以用来恢复私钥。助记词是根据一定算法生成的一组单词,即使用户丢失了私钥,只要妥善保管助记词,就可以通过恢复功能重新生成私钥,恢复钱包访问权。
但需要注意的是,助记词同样需要保护妥善。如果他人得知助记词,用户的资产也会面临被盗的风险。因此,上述提到的私钥保护措施同样适用于助记词。
证明自己是钱包的合法拥有者通常需要通过签名证明系统。用户可以利用自己的私钥对特定的信息或交易进行签名,以此创建一段数字签名。
例如,当用户想要向其他人证明自己是一个特定以太坊地址的拥有者时,可以选择签署一个“挑战信息”。这通常是一个随机生成的数字或字符串,接收者可以要求用户生成一个针对该信息的签名。接收者将使用用户公钥验证签名,并确认该发起签名的人确实是公钥的持有者。
此过程展示了用户对钱包的控制,但同时在无意间也保护了用户的隐私,因为对方并不需要获取用户的私钥或助记词。只要用户能够出示有效的签名,便可以清晰证明自己是钱包的合法拥有者。
在数字货币交易中,无论是新手还是老手,都会面临一系列的安全风险。了解这些风险并采取措施加以防范,是保护资产的重要一步。
首先,网络钓鱼是最常见的安全风险之一。黑客可能通过伪造电子邮件或创建假网站来骗取用户的登录凭据。用户应时刻保持警惕,确保自己访问的网站是合法的,尽量通过官方渠道获取信息。如果接收到不明链接的电子邮件或消息,用户应直接通过官方渠道进行验证。
其二,恶意软件也是一大隐患。黑客可能通过恶意软件获取用户的私钥或其他敏感信息。因此,保持设备的安全性是关键。用户应定期更新操作系统和软件,安装防病毒软件,并避免下载疑似恶意的应用程序或文件。
此外,社交工程也是一种流行的攻击手段。黑客可能试图通过与用户聊天,获取其个人信息。用户应谨慎对待社交平台上的陌生人,避免透露任何涉及自己钱包或私钥的信息。
最后,用户可以借助硬件钱包或多重签名技术来提高资产安全性。硬件钱包可以提供离线存储,降低被盗的风险;而多重签名则要求多个私钥共同签署才能完成交易,从而提高安全性。
总结来说,数字货币交易虽为便捷与创新的融资手段,但也伴随多种安全挑战。在使用以太坊进行钱包所有权签名证明及交易时,用户应提高警惕,共同维护金融安全。
本文介绍了以太坊签名证明钱包所有权的基本概念、操作步骤及常见问题。希望能帮助读者更好地理解数字资产的管理及安全防范。无论是新手还是老手,对加密货币的风险和安全都应保持高度重视,以确保自身的资产安全。